Boys Lacrosse: De La Salle Comeback Ends Foothill's Title Hopes in 2OT
Spartans upset top-seeded Foothill 11-10
Through three quarters of Friday's North Coast Section boys lacrosse championship, Foothill High looked poised to win its first title in school history.
The Falcons took an 8-4 lead into the final quarter before things went awry.
In a span of less than five minutes, De La Salle scored five-straight goals and eventually won 11-10 on a Chris Pereira goal in double-overtime.

"We had a tough time with the face-offs in the fourth and it didn't seem like we had the ball for more than 10 seconds at a time the whole period," Foothill coach Bob McManus said. "You can't do that against a good team like De La Salle."
Starting goalie Ben Krebs was knocked out of the game with a concussion with six minutes, 38 seconds left and was replaced by sophomore Patrick Shevelson, who came up big down the stretch to keep Foothill in the game.

After Scott Wheaton gave Foothill a 10-9 led with 3:04 left in regulation the top-seeded Falcons liked their chances, but Pereira snuck a shot past Shevelson with 10.1 seconds left to force overtime.
The teams traded a few good opportunities in the first overtime, but nothing came of them.
With 2:46 left in the second overtime, Pereira came with a lefty shot to win the game for De La Salle — a team Foothill beat twice during the regular season.
"I was expecting him to go high, but he snuck it low in the corner," Shevelson said. "There was nothing I could do, it was a great shot."
The disappointing loss ended the best Foothill season in school history.
"We had a great season, it was the best team we've ever had," McManus said.
Several seniors will attempt to play college lacrosse next year, including Broc Schall (Arizona State), Ross Porter (Cal Poly), Michael Lambrecht (U.C. Santa Barbara) and Wheaton (Santa Clara).
The Falcons finish the year ranked No. 3 in the state and No. 31 in the nation by laxpower.com — a spot ahead of De La Salle in each poll.

North Coast Section Finals
No. 2 De La Salle 11, No. 1 Foothill 10 (2OT)
De La Salle (18-6) 3 1 0 6 0 1 — 11
Foothill (18-5) 4 2 2 2 0 0 — 10
Scoring: De La Salle — Mullin 3, Collins 2, Doolittle 2, Pereira 2, Carmassi, Evans. Foothill — Lambrecht 2, Wheaton 2, Kacinski 2, Schall 2, Benson, Garcia.
Saves: Wilm (DLS) 16, Krebs (F) 8, Shevelson (F) 4.
